Rotation Direction

This indicates the rotation direction when viewed from the output shaft side.
The rotation direction of the gearhead output shaft relative to the standard type motor output shaft varies depending on the gear type and gear ratio. Please check the following table.

Type Gear Ratio Rotation Direction as Viewed From the Motor Output Shaft Side
 
TS Geared Type 3.6, 7.2, 10 Same direction
20, 30 Opposite direction
TH Geared Type
Frame size 28 mm
7.2, 10 Opposite direction
20, 30 Same direction
TH Geared Type
Frame size 42 mm, 60 mm, 90 mm
3.6, 7.2, 10 Same direction
20, 30 Opposite direction
SH Geared Type
Frame size 28 mm
7.2, 36 Same direction
9, 10, 18 Opposite direction
SH Geared Type
Frame size 42 mm, 60 mm
3.6, 7.2, 9, 10 Same direction
18, 36 Opposite direction
SH Geared Type
Frame size 90 mm
3.6, 7.2, 9, 10, 18 Same direction
36 Opposite direction

Permissible Moment Load and Permissible Axial Load

The permissible moment load and permissible axial load should not exceed the permissible values in the table below.

Type Gear Ratio Permissible Moment Load (N·m) Permissible Axial Load (N)
AR69 5 10 200
10 12.5 300
20 16 400
40 16 500
AR911 5 45 400
10 55 600
20 58 800
40 58 1200

The permissible moment load and permissible axial load can be calculated by the following formulas.

  • Example 1: When external force F is added at distance L from the center of the output flange
     

    Moment Load [N·m]: M = F ×L
    Permissible Axial Load (N): Fs = F + load applied

    Example 1: When external force F is added at distance L from the center of the output flange
  • Example 2: When external forces F1 and F2 are added at distance L from the output flange-mounting surface
     

    Moment Load [N·m]: M = F2 × (L + a)
    Permissible Axial Load (N): Fs = F1 + load applied

    Example 2: When external forces F1 and F2 are added at distance L from the output flange-mounting surface
    Type Coefficient a (m)
    AR69 0.022
    AR911 0.035
